Manganese sulfide

98%

  • Product Code: 204787
  Alias:    Manganese sulfide (II)
  CAS:    18820-29-6
Molecular Weight: 87 g./mol Molecular Formula: MnS
EC Number: 242-599-3 MDL Number: MFCD00014210
Melting Point: 1610°C Boiling Point:
Density: 3.99 g/cm3 Storage Condition: Room temperature, flammable area, seal
Product Description: Used as a pigment in ceramics and glass for producing pink to red hues. Acts as a catalyst in certain chemical reactions, especially in organic synthesis. Employed in the production of dry cell batteries due to its electrochemical properties. Serves as a precursor in the synthesis of other manganese compounds. Also investigated for use in semiconductor applications and solar cells because of its optical and electronic characteristics.
